**ACCOUNTABILITY STATEMENT**:
The DevOps Lead will provide leadership and oversight that will guide the planning, development and operations of all centralized IT services, and will support current and new technology initiatives that align with the business objectives of Ontario Northland. This position is responsible for overseeing the technical aspects of enterprise projects and ensuring that they are completed to the highest standard while providing technical leadership to the project team.
**MAJOR DUTIES/ RESPONSIBILITIES**:
- Provide leadership, guidance and instruction to the IT DevOps team
- Review new and existing projects to determine resource assignment requirements
- Provide reports to the Manager, IT DevOps on resource allocation
- Review code and support Software Development Lifecycle (SDLC) processes
- Review current development systems and solutions and deliver guidance on product lifecycle, upgrades and migration opportunities
- Collaborate with staff and departments to ensure smooth and reliable operation of software and systems
- Collaborate with 3rd party Cloud providers for integrations with our systems for authentication and data imports/exports
- Support the execution of data collection for system development
- Conduct analysis regarding data integrity and initiate mitigation measures
- Contribute to the quality assurance of data and information and support ongoing process improvement
- Assist with data migration, data cleansing, and data integration activities to ensure accurate and seamless transfer of data between systems
- Assist with EAM/ERP design and engineer new policies, upgrades and update documentation
- Collaborate with vendors and consultants as needed, to ensure effective implementation and maintenance of the EAM/ERP system, and other IT systems and services.
- Serve as a key facilitator during kick-offs, workshops, training sessions, and other meetings as required
- Establish requirements and participate in the evaluation for Request for Proposals (RFP)
- Provide regular updates and reports, including KPIs and metrics to the Manager, IT DevOps
**REQUIREMENTS**:
- Post secondary diploma or degree in Information Technology, Business, Computer Science, related field of study or equivalent experience
- Minimum of one of the following certifications is preferred: Information Technology Infrastructure Library (ITIL); Project Management Professional (PMP); Prosci Change Management
- 5+ years of experience as IT DevOps within an enterprise and/or public sector setting
-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office Tools (PowerPoint, Word, Excel)
- Experience directing development teams in all aspects of the software development life cycle (SDLC), including design, development, coding, testing, and debugging, to deliver high-quality solutions
- Ability to write testable, scalable, and efficient code and setting coding standards for the team
- Experience with the implementation of major business systems (ERP, EAM, MRP)
- Knowledge of EAM/ERP systems (such as SAP, Oracle, Hexagon EAM, Infor, Microsoft Dynamics) with experience in configuration
- Familiar with Change Management, Business Analysis and Project Management methodologies (ADKAR, Waterfall, Agile, Scrum, Risk Management, etc.) and supporting tools
- Exceptional interpersonal skills, with a focus on listening, coaching, judgement and decision making
- Bilingualism considered an asset
- Commitment to company health and safety
